By Pictolic https://pictolic.com/article/diving-with-sharks-and-other-wonders-of-the-underwater-kingdom.htmlMexican photographer and anthropologist Patane Anuar (Anuar Patjane) makes an incredible black and white photographs of marine life, revealing for us the amazing underwater world. A photographer is sent into the abyss to meet with sharks, whales, stingrays or dolphins, which, through complex and exciting tracks, as if bathed in light.
Anuar Patane — winner of World Press Photo in the category "Nature" is the winner of National Geographic Traveler.
The work of talented Mexican photographer demonstrate how Grand life under water, we guess only in pictures. Their spectacular photographs, he hopes to draw attention to the issue of the protection of the environment and fauna.
Patane photographs not only underwater life, but also landscapes of different countries of the world. More of his works, including a series of photos taken in Antarctica and Iceland, you can find on the official website of photographer and instagram.
